In recent years, the Private Rented Sector has become vastly more regulated and this only looks set to increase. That's why it is crucial that landlords partner with a local letting agency which is up to date with all the latest legislation. There are substantial fines and penalties for non-compliance and there is an increased chance that landlords who self-manage could be caught out.

What's more, the rental sector is changing. More tenants are renting for longer and view their rental property as their long-term home. Landlords must adapt to this shift and cater their properties to changing tenant expectations. This is where the advice of a letting agent, who is in tune with the needs of the local market, could be invaluable.

For many reasons corporate lettings are becoming more and more popular with landlords. You can offer homes to a steady stream of professional tenants safe in the knowledge that the rent is often paid by their employer or organisation. This is highly likely to lower the chances of late payments and arrears as you will know the rent is coming from a reputable company.

The majority of professional tenants will also be used to renting which could reduce the chances of complications occurring during the tenancy and maximise the chance of them treating your property as their own.

The steady stream of tenants provided by companies through corporate lets can be highly effective in reducing void periods - as one employee moves on, another is needed to replace them and the cycle continues.

Property maintenance can cause one of the biggest issues between landlords and tenants so it can be hugely productive to have a professional middle party to manage the relationship.

Moreover, tackling property maintenance issues quickly and effectively could be vital to the future of your property. If you deal with a problem early, you reduce the chances of it getting worse and costing you more time and money in the long-run. Working with professional contractors, who carry out maintenance jobs to the highest standard, could also stop property problems from reoccurring.
